Around Kaltern
This gravel bike loop is perfect for exploring Kaltern and its diverse landscape. While it only scratches the surface of the extensive trail network, it offers a well-curated selection of the best routes and provides a great feel for the area.
The tour begins with a ride into the forest on the western slope of the Adige Valley, between the sports center and the picturesque hamlet of Altenburg. Here, one of the most beautiful viewpoints awaits, with a spectacular view over Lake Kaltern. From there, the route crosses over to the opposite side towards the Mitterberg. This distinctive hill rises between Kaltern and the Adige, with steep 400-meter cliffs on the valley side and a gentle slope descending towards Kaltern.
The next highlight is the impressive Steintal. The trail follows the wooded slopes of the Mitterberg and passes the idyllic Montiggler Lakes. From there, the final stage begins: vineyards line the path back towards Girlan, before the tour comes to a close in Kaltern.
This varied loop combines challenging forest sections, panoramic stretches, and gentle vineyard hills – an ideal discovery tour for gravel bike enthusiasts.
